Springs’ summer camps and activities

From Kamp Kool, dance, etiquette, sport and special needs camps to swimming and tennis programs, Coral Springs is offering a host of summer camps and activities.

Parents will find a wide selection of quality programs and unique amenities suited for all ages and abilities in the city’s Summer Fun Guide. The guide and applications are available at the Coral Springs Gymnasium, 2501 Coral Springs Drive; City Hall in the Mall, Coral Square Mall; the Coral Springs Aquatic Complex, Tennis Center of Coral Springs, 2575 Sportsplex Drive; and the Cypress Park Tennis Center.

Guides are also available at City Hall, located at 9551 West Sample Road. To view and download the guide and application forms, visit coralsprings.org/summerfun. Call 954-345-2200.
